BANDAR SERI BEGAWAN: The Tourism Development Department under the Ministry of Economy, Trade and Industry on Saturday (June 6) announced the appointment of two international tourism marketing representatives in South Korea and Japan to mark a strategic step in strengthening Brunei Darussalam’s destination marketing and trade engagement in East Asia.
Under this appointment, TAMS Inc has been engaged as Brunei Tourism’s Marketing Representative for South Korea, while World Compass Co Ltd has been appointed for Japan.
Both representatives will support Brunei Tourism’s long-term strategy to strengthen visibility, increase market penetration and enhance collaboration with travel trade stakeholders.
The appointments will run until 2029, ensuring sustained in-market support over the next three years.
In 2025, South Korea recorded 7,914 air arrivals and Japan with 13,200, with both markets remaining important East Asian sources, reflecting steady travel demand and strong growth potential.
The initiative aims to position Brunei Darussalam as a distinctive destination offering authentic and immersive travel experiences, including nature-based tourism, cultural heritage exploration, and niche segments such as diving, birdwatching and nature-oriented travel.
